A leading independent fire consultancy is seeking a Fire Surveyor to join their team, supporting a range of complex projects across London and the Home Counties. This is a fully remote Fire Surveyor role, requiring site travel as needed, including occasional overnight stays.
The Fire Surveyor's Role
The Fire Surveyor will be responsible for delivering high-quality Fire Risk Assessment (FRA) reports across a variety of building types, many of which are complex - from listed heritage assets and architecturally unique properties to conventional commercial, residential, and mixed-use buildings.
In this role, the Fire Surveyor will also be involved in drafting retrospective fire strategies, fire safety management plans, audits, occupancy reviews, and RIBA stage 2-6 fire reports. Additional duties include providing client-facing consultancy and site monitoring work as part of Regulation 38 safety cases.

Level 4/5 Diploma in Fire SafetyTechnical knowledge should include:
Building Regulations 2010 (experience of its functional requirements)
Fire Safety Order (FSO), including changes under the Building Safety Act 2022
Fire Safety (England) Regulations 2022
ADB Vols 1 & 2, BS9999, BS9991, BS7974, PD 7974-6: 2004
Understanding of fire engineering principles (e.g., CIBSE Guide E, BRE 187)In Return?
